About This Opportunity
The D.A. Murchison Memorial Award in Music is awarded to a returning student in the Music program who is in good academic standing and has displayed extraordinary volunteerism and leadership on campus and in the greater community. This award was established through the estate of Evelyn Patricia 'Patty' Matheson, who lived a long and productive life and passed away at the age of 98. Based on her belief in the value of post-secondary education, Evelyn Matheson left a substantial bequest to the University of Prince Edward Island, including funding for four scholarships. This particular award, one of four established through her estate, honours her uncle D.A. Murchison and is designed to support a student at UPEI who is enrolled in the field of Music.
